WebAug 25, 2024 · From the Tools menu, select NuGet Package Manager > Package Manager Console. In the Package Manager Console (PMC), type the following command: Install-Package Microsoft.AspNet.WebApi.Client. The preceding command adds the following NuGet packages to the project: Microsoft.AspNet.WebApi.Client. Newtonsoft.Json. Web1. WebApr 10, 2024 · The HTTP POST method sends data to the server. The type of the body of the request is indicated by the Content-Type header.. The difference between PUT and POST is that PUT is idempotent: calling it once or several times successively has the same effect (that is no side effect), where successive identical POST may have additional …
